National Father’s Day Council honors Todd Wanek as Tampa Bay Father of the Year

Other honorees included fellow Tampa Bay leaders John Couris, Lavonte David and Oscar Horton at inaugural event 

TAMPA, Fla. — The National Father’s Day Council honored Todd Wanek, president and CEO of Ashley Furniture Industries; Oscar Horton, chairman and CEO of Sun State International Trucks; John Couris, president and CEO of Tampa General Hospital; and Lavonte David, Tampa Bay Buccaneer Super Bowl Winner and All-Time Leading Tackler at the First Annual Tampa Bay Father of the Year Awards. 

The awards luncheon took place on Wednesday, June 17, in Tampa, with proceeds benefiting Big Brothers Big Sisters of Tampa Bay, which creates and supports one-to-one mentoring relationships that ignite the power and promise of youth. 

“Each year, we are proud to recognize fathers whose leadership extends well beyond their professional accomplishments,” said Michael Haskel, CEO and president of The Father’s Day/Mother’s Day Council Inc. “As we launch this inaugural Tampa Bay celebration, we are honored to recognize four extraordinary leaders whose impact on the region — and devotion to family — truly embody the spirit of this event and the mission it supports.” 

Under Todd’s leadership, Ashley has grown to be the world’s largest home furnishings manufacturer and the largest furniture store brand in North America. The company has experienced significant global growth while maintaining a strong commitment to community engagement and philanthropy. 

“One of the things that I enjoy in life, more than anything, is being a father,” said Wanek. “The Father of the Year Award represents people who take responsibility — not just for themselves, but for others, and I’m honored to be recognized alongside so many who live that commitment every day.”  

As part of its continued commitment to supporting family-focused philanthropies, The Father’s Day/Mother’s Day Council Inc. has donated more than $39 million to organizations nationwide serving mothers, fathers and children.
